DELHI, N.Y. — The SUNY Delhi softball team dropped both ends of a North Atlantic Conference doubleheader at home to #20 Husson on Friday, falling 13-1 in five innings in game one before a 9-1 loss in the nightcap.

Game One: Husson 13, SUNY Delhi 1 (5 innings)

Delhi kept the game close through four innings, trailing 2-0 entering the fifth before Husson exploded for 11 runs in the final frame to end the contest by run rule. Morgan Curtis paced the Eagles with two hits and four RBI, while Emily Dunbar went 3-for-3 with two RBI. Husson starter Ana Lang struck out 11 over five innings of one-hit ball, with the lone Delhi run coming in the fifth on a Samantha Martin RBI groundout that scored Riley Martin. Angelina Dickel took the loss in the circle for Delhi.

Game Two: Husson 9, SUNY Delhi 1

Husson struck early again, putting up a run in the first on a Morgan Curtis RBI fielder's choice and adding four more in the second highlighted by a Curtis three-RBI single. Delhi got on the board in the fourth when Stephanie Huckabee doubled to right center and came around to score on a Carly Bernard RBI groundout. Husson tacked on insurance runs in the fourth, fifth, and sixth to put the game out of reach. Curtis finished with five RBI on the day for the Eagles. Huckabee, Riley Martin, and Jaden Taylor each collected a hit for Delhi, and Alethea Ferrara took the loss across 3.1 innings of work.

Delhi falls to 9-18 on the season and returns to action Saturday at 10 a.m, hosting UMPI for senior recognition day.
